The Telekine (3.5 class, by request)

Hit Die: 1d8
Class Skills:
The telekine’s class skills (and the key ability for each skill) are Bluff (Cha), Concentration (Con), Craft (Int), Diplomacy (Cha), Disable Device (Int), Knowledge (Psionics) (Int), Open Lock (Dex), Profession (Wis), Sleight of Hand (Dex), and Spot (Wis).
Skill Points at 1st Level: (4 + Int modifier) × 4
Skill Points at Each Additional Level: 4 + Int modifier
Weapon and Armour Proficiency
Telekines are proficient with all simple weapons as well as the rapier, the scimitar, and the short sword. They are also proficient with light armour. A telekine needs their offhand to be free for their telekinetic abilities to function properly, but wearing medium or heavy armour doesn't interfere with their abilities apart from the nonproficiency penalty.
Telekinetic Force (Su)
Telekines' signature power is, of course, telekinesis. A telekine can lift from afar an amount determined by their charisma score and the multiplier listed under Telekinesis Weight on Table: The Telekine. To find out how much a telekine can lift, take the values on Table: Carrying Capacity, ignoring the telekine's size and number of legs and using their charisma in place of their strength, and multiply them by the number given under Telekinesis Weight. For example, a tenth-level telekine with 20 charisma uses 266, 532 and 800. The telekine can lift a "Light load" telekinetically at up to the speed listed on Table: The Telekine, a "Medium load" at a half of that speed and a "Heavy load" at a quarter of that speed. Round down to the next 5 ft increment.
Telekines can wield weapons like this by throwing them physically at their enemies. In this case, the telekine is considered essentially to be whacking the enemy with the item directly, using the telekine's charisma modifier in place of their strength modifier, and is considered proficient with the item no matter what.
A telekine can wield multiple items and control them independently as a single standard action but their weights are combined to determine the speed at which they move. A telekine can move willing creatures but not unwilling creatures. Objects and creatures being moved do not fall between turns.
This ability works on anything up to 1000 ft + 100 ft/level away.
Psychic Hammer (Ps)
At first level, and every fourth level, the telekine unlocks a powerful telekinetic attack which deals the amount of damage listed and knocks the target back the distance listed; the range is medium (100 ft + 10 ft/level). A fortitude save (DC 10 + half the telekine's level + the telekine's charisma modifer) halves the damage and knockback. The telekine can choose to do no damage or to knock the target back only part of the distance or both.
Ranged Legerdemain (Su)
A telekine can perform one of the following class skills at a range of 60 feet: Disable Device, Open Lock, or Sleight of Hand. A telekine cannot take 10 on this check. Any object to be manipulated must weigh less than the telekine's telekinetic light load.
A telekine can use ranged legerdemain once per day at second level and once more per day every four levels thereafter.
Telekinetic Reflection (Su)
A telekine gets a +1 deflection bonus to AC at 3rd level, which increases by 1 every 4 levels thereafter. Further, any attack which misses due to this deflection bonus (for example, at 7th level, any attack roll whose total result is 1 or 2 points below the telekine's armour class except for a natural 20 or 1) is reflected onto the attacker, who immediately hits themself.
Telekinetic Storm (Ps)
A telekine can increase or decrease the wind speed by 1 step at 5th level and 1 more step every 4 levels thereafter as a standard action in an area up to 60 feet in diameter within medium range for one round.Last edited by Jormengand; 2017-12-22 at 06:54 PM.

Telekinetic Reflection is awesome, turning defense into a powerful offense that has no counter measures.
Psychic Hammer: I'd allow iterative attacks. (and I'd change the name to Telekinetic Hammer. "Psychic" is already reserved for psionic powers)
Telekinetic Storm: you should state that a telekine is affected less severely by wind according to the number of steps s/he can modify.
Telekinesis Weight: Badly needs simplification. There's nothing sacred about 20 steps. It could easily be 10 or 7 or 6 or 5..... and I believe you can make it overshadow Telekinesis spell effect with a clear conscience. After all, that's what the class is all about.
Also, if the class is all about (and only about) telekinesis, Ranged Legerdemain shouldn't have daily uses limits.
And what about self-propelling telekinesis? If not, then at least give it Balance and Jump as class skills, with some serious modifiers.
I also find things like Telekinetic Combat Maneuver, Telekinetic Grapple, Telekinetic Wave and Telekinetic Bubble to be things worthy of adding (replacing multiple instances of Ranged Legerdemain, according to the above note).

Just wanted to flesh out my proposals above (with some extra)

Additional Class Skills: Balance, Escape Artist
Telekinetic Force (Su)
As given in the OP. The speed at which objects can be moved equals 30' / round per class level.
Optional: Telekinetic Force extends to Long Range (400 ft. + 40 ft./level). Anything beyond that is nonstandard and seems pointless to me.
Telekinetic Hammer (Ex)
As given in the OP for Psychic Hammer.
Telekinetic Hammer is a ranged-touch attack that's applicable for iterative attacks. Only BAB that's obtained by Telekine levels is applicable for iterative attacks when making a Telekinetic Hammer attack.
Telekinetic Hammer deals Force damage.
Telekinetic Hammer is inapplicable for AoOs.
Telekinetic Reflection (Su)
As given in the OP. Telekinetic Reflection grants deflection bonus to AC according to the given value.
Attacks that are redirected back at the source don't automatically hit, but rather are resolved at the attacker's normal attack roll.
Telekinetic Storm (Su)
As given in the OP. The telekine is affected less severely by ambient wind (self only) according to the number of steps s/he can modify.
Telekinetic Combat Maneuver (Ex)
Starting at 6th level, When making a Telekinetic Hammer attack, you may spend a use of Ranged Legerdemain ability to perform any standard combat maneuver (Bull Rush, Disarm, Grapple, Overrun or Trip).
When using Telekinetic Combat Maneuver, the maneuver's normally associated ability score is replaced with the telekine's Charisma modifier.
Using Grapple telekinetically requires concentration.
The target of your telekinetic Grapple cannot gain a hold or pin, only avoid disadvantage. Your telekinetic Grapple counts as a creature whose size equals that of the target.
Telekinetic Flight (Ex)
At 10th level, you become airborne, and may fly telekinetically indefinitely. This requires no special effort on your part.
Telekinetic Wave (Su)
Starting at 14th level, when making a Telekinetic Hammer attack, as a standard action, you may spend a use of Ranged Legerdemain ability to influence all creatures and objects in a 30' cone.
You may spend multiple daily uses of Ranged Legerdemain to double/triple/quadruple/etc. the range of the cone.
Telekinetic Bubble (Su)
Starting at 18th level, you may spend 3 uses daily of Ranged Legerdemain as a standard action to produce a Telekinetic Sphere spell effect
